Use Proper Gear, Good hiking boots, poles, rain jacket and pack all season. Weather shifts fast. Carry basic first aid kit.
Insurance, Make sure your travel insurance covers high altitude trekking and emergency evacuation.
Stay on Trail, Always checking with your guide before heading outside. Respect nature and the people - it's their home you're walking through.
Trek with Guide, For safety and better local knowledge, get Information from your guide each day and understand your plan thoroughly.
Hydration, A bottle in hand is your silent bodyguard. Drink at least 3-4 liters of water daily to prevent altitude sickness.
Know the Symptoms of AMS, Headache, nausea, dizziness, shortness of breath .
Especially during the spring season after Himalayan, there can be snowslides along the ABC route, so it's important to be with a guide. On the way to Poon Hill, you will encounter many donkeys used by local people for transportation of goods, please be alert and give them space on narrow trails.
